After Will Smith slapped Chris Rock at the 2022 Academy Awards ceremony, the Academy Award for ‘The Williams Method’ has stayed away from social networks, but after undergoing rehabilitation, being banned from gala for 10 years and obviously apologizing, he decided it’s time to return.

Will Smith returns to social media after the slap

Smith shared a curious video of some gorillas on Instagram with the following message: “I try to get back on social media.” In the comments you can read Justin Bieber saying he missed him, exclaimed Cesar Millan “the animal kingdom is with you” and singer Jade Novah welcomes him. These are generally positive messages advising you to come back without worrying what they will say.

damaged reputation

However, although responses to this publication are mostly in the actor’s favor, according to a report by Q Scores, his reputation was seriously damaged and he was one of Hollywood’s most loved stars. Also, before the slap, he was in the top 5 of the 10 most popular actors on this list that Q Scores makes every six months, in January and July, among 1,800 North Americans over the age of 6. Together with him the regulars on the top step of the podium are Tom Hanks and Denzel Washington.

According to media reports by Henry Schafer, a spokesman for Q Scores, he had a 39 percent in the January study, which refers to the number of people who consider him their favorite star. in the July report it dropped to 24, that is, only 24% of the people interviewed choose it now. Schafer considers it “a significant and precipitous decline”. At the same time the negative notes have doubled, from 10% to 26% who consider her a “normal” star. According to Schafer, the average is usually 16% or at most 17%.

In addition, Jada Pinkett Smith also suffered the consequences in her public image and her positive score, already low, dropped from 13% to 6% and the negative one went from 29 to 44%. In reverse, Chris Rock’s rating has not changed significantly and it remains 20% positive and 14% negative, although it has become more popular.
